Federal Grants & Tax Incentives
These programs provide nationwide funding, tax credits, and financial incentives for historic preservation projects.
Historic Preservation Fund (HPF)
- Description: Managed by the National Park Service (NPS), this fund provides matching grants for restoration, planning, and preservation projects.
- More Info: http://www.nps.gov/subjects/historicpreservationfund
Federal Historic Tax Credit (HTC)
- Description: Owners of income-generating historic buildings may qualify for a 20% tax credit on qualified rehabilitation expenses.
- More Info: http://www.nps.gov/tps/tax-incentives.htm
Save America’s Treasures Grant
- Description: Provides funding for the preservation of nationally significant historic properties, monuments, and collections.
- More Info: http://www.nps.gov/subjects/historicpreservationfund/save-americas-treasures-grants.htm
Paul Bruhn Historic Revitalization Grants
- Description: Supports rehabilitation of historic buildings in rural communities to promote economic development.
- More Info: http://www.nps.gov/subjects/historicpreservationfund/paul-bruhn-historic-revitalization-grants-program.htm
American Battlefield Protection Program (ABPP)
- Description: Provides grants for the preservation and interpretation of significant American battlefield sites.
- More Info: http://www.nps.gov/subjects/battlefields
